About the Property

Spa and Recreational Amenities
Indulge in massages, body treatments, and facials at the spa. Enjoy 2 outdoor swimming pools, a nightclub, and a complimentary water park for endless entertainment.
Dining and Drinking Options
Satisfy your cravings at one of the 6 restaurants or grab snacks at the cafe. Unwind with a drink from the swim-up bar or one of the 7 bars/lounges available on-site.
Convenient Facilities and Services
Benefit from amenities like a computer station, dry cleaning services, and a 24-hour front desk. Free self-parking makes your stay hassle-free.

Property Notes

Reservations are required for golf tee times, massage services, and spa treatments. Reservations can be made by contacting the property prior to arrival, using the contact information on the booking confirmation. Guests under 18 years old are not permitted at this adults-only property. Only registered guests are allowed in the guestrooms. The property has connecting/adjoining rooms, which are subject to availability and can be requested by contacting the property using the number on the booking confirmation. No pets and no service animals are allowed at this property.

"Good vacation"

10.0

We have been numerous times to RIU Bambu and Republica, and for this winter decided to try Macao. It was a good choice and a great vacation. Following are our notes and observations: Beach: Great as always in this area. Beautiful sand, some waves, no stones. There were more seaweeds this year than we know from previous visits, but they were promptly cleaned up. There are no palapas on any of the RIU properties, but a lot of palm trees for the shade. It's actually good this way. No problem finding empty chair any time of the day. One small problem: no facility to wash feet leaving the beach. Lots of people bring sand on the walkway which the staff has to clean constantly. Grounds: Very nice and taken care of. Personnel cleans all areas constantly during the day. Resort is very compact. Everything is close by. Pools: A little more difficult to get the perfect spot there, but there was always a place, sometimes not in the shade though. We hang around the swim-up bar pool, as a nice Latin music played there most of the day. Food: We only used the buffet, as we learned that the ala carte restaurants are not really worth it. The food was generally very good with a big selection. The restaurant has indoor and outdoor sections, the outdoor becoming a bit crowded at breakfast time. Service was fast and attentive. The only complain about food is that breads sucked and one of us is a bread lover. Bars: As usual drinks were hit and miss, sometimes diluted, sometimes too strong. Our favourite espresso martini was made with coffee liquor instead of Kahlua like in many other resorts in Punta Cana. There is a special coffee bar serving good coffees and a decent selection of pastries. Room: We got a nice room on upper floor with king bed as requested at booking. It was modern, spacious and functional. The bathroom had a night light triggered by motion and light projected into the bedroom through semi transparent wall. We couldn't figure out how to disable it and had to resort to turning complete power off at night. Entertainment: It sucked, as in other RIU resorts these days, especially in the evenings and especially on the days where there was a RIU party. We attended some in the previous years and figured out it's not what we like. Besides they are "seen one, seen all". The live band played only once, otherwise it was soloist or duet. The only original good show worth mentioning was actually a 3 tenors performance. Very surprising. The entertainment schedule is not always followed, and can change suddenly at the last moment. Nothing different from other resorts. Overall we enjoyed our vacation and despite some critical notes here, we will return again.

"RIU Palace Macao – Bottom of the RIU League Table"

4.0

We stayed at RIU Palace Macao from 29 December to 12 January, and as a long-standing RIU member, I can honestly say this has been the most disappointing RIU experience we’ve ever had. We have previously stayed at: RIU Palace Mexico (twice) RIU Palace Riviera Maya RIU Palace Peninsula RIU Palace Pacifico RIU Palace Jamaica RIU Chiclana We are also booked for RIU Palace Maldives in 2026, which we are now seriously considering cancelling as a direct result of this stay. First impressions: On arrival, my wife and I were given one welcome drink to share — not the start you expect from a “Palace” resort. The only consistently positive aspect of this hotel was the bar and waiting staff. Their work ethic, enthusiasm, and friendliness were excellent. They worked extremely hard and genuinely deserved tips. Accommodation: Room 3002 Shower leaked badly, flooding the bathroom floor Cockroaches present in the bathroom (reported; cleaners attempted to resolve but the issue continued) Balcony overlooked the gym and car park — far from ideal Prior to travel, I emailed requesting a paid upgrade. I was told availability would be checked on arrival. At check-in, we were then told this could only be reviewed during our final 7 days. Meanwhile, we were informed by others that other guests had received upgrades by paying cash at reception, which was frustrating and inconsistent. Housekeeping was also unreliable — coffee sachets were often not replenished, and we had to chase the cleaner multiple times. Score: 4/10 Food: Initially, I thought some negative reviews were exaggerated — they were not. Buffet food was lukewarm at best. Multiple guests reported upset stomachs, particularly after eating Red Snapper at the Krystal restaurant. Overall quality was well below RIU Palace standards The Asian restaurant was the best option but still not exceptional Score: 5/10 Entertainment: We attended one event and chose not to return. Based on that experience, it was not appealing enough to comment further. Drinks: Drinks were up to RIU standard, with good service from bar staff. Score: 8/10 Service: Staff worked hard throughout the resort, but there was a clear lack of visible management. Stronger leadership is needed to ensure consistent standards. Score: 6/10 Pools: Pools are in serious need of refurbishment. Missing mosaic tiles, cracked concrete around pool areas, Generally dirty, particularly in the pool bar Score: 4/10 Overall Summary: This hotel is not a Palace. It does not meet 5-star standards. At best, it is a 3.5-star resort. For loyal RIU guests, this property is a major disappointment and falls well short of what the brand usually represents.
